Mike Flanagan is a modern Master of Horror, who is capable of telling stories on both the big and small screen. From Netflix's "Saving Hill House" to his insidious micro-budget thriller "Hush", the man proved time and time again received the goods. More specifically, Flanagan has shown that he knows what is needed to make a great adaptation to Steven King, with the director puting his stamp on the "Life of Chuck" later this year. For King's fans, (I hope) the best is yet to come as Flanagan is working to bring the author's "dark tower" The saga in life as a TV series.
While many remain in the air, King gave the project his blessing. More than that, he was not so far classified to classify Flanagan's "Dark Tower" as "perfect". At a recent episode of "The Kingdom", " Host Eric Vesp grew up the upcoming TV show and, while the famous author would not say too much, what he offered was extremely encouraging. By king:
"I've seen scenarios and terrains. It starts where it should start. The blows are perfect. They are just perfect. "
"He's a king whisper," King joked about Flanagan's growing reputation for the possibility of successfully adjusting the author's most challenging works, With "Ericerald's Game" in 2017 it may be the biggest example. ("Doctor Sleep" is certainly another.) Since the "dark tower" consists of eight books published over several decades, it would certainly be fair to say that the adjustment of this spraying EP qualifies as a challenge. This is to say nothing of the heavenly expectations that fans have for the show. Without pressure.
Something ironic, 2017 is the same year that The film "Dark Tower" hit theaters and bombed the box officeserves as a critical and commercial disaster. That film, directed by Nikolai Arcel, starred Idris Elba as Roland Deskin, Aka Gunslinger, appeared with Matthew McConaughey as Walter Padick, Aka Randall Flagg, aka the man in black.

To say that the adoption of a satisfying, faithful adaptation of the most ambitious King story on the screen is difficult to underestimate. After the film "Dark Tower" failed, Amazon tried to make A. TV -Show "Dark Tower" with former show -Show of "The Walking Dead" Glen Mazarathat was later abolished. Mazara's plan was to start a "wizard and glass", which is the fourth book in the series as a whole, instead of "Gunslinger", which was first and originally published in 1982. What about where flangan intends to start? It remains to be seen, although King seems to have a real idea.
Flanagan also feels like a real person for the job. Between his TV shows experience such as "Midnight Mass" and his proven performance by doing King's work to sing on the screen, it's hard to argue not to put it at the head. The only problem is that Flanagan is a very, very busy person. He is currently working on a new "exorcist" film about Blumhouse and UniversalWhat seems to be his next project. Also on the front of the king, He develops a TV version of "Kerry" for the premiere video.
Flanagan provided a little update to the project in November 2024, comparing the series "Dark Tower" to "Launching an Oil Tanker". He also explained that the play "was first stopped by me moving from Netflix to Amazon and again stalled by strikes". For those who may not remember, 2023 also saw the guild of the actors on the screen, and America's guys on America went on strike for months. With every happiness, after Flanagan ends with an "exorcist", this long -awaited project can really start.
